The typical first-time homebuyer is now 38 years old, nearly a decade older than in the 1980s, with experts attributing the change to high prices and mortgage rates. It now takes six-figure incomes to afford a home, and bidding wars are driving up prices. Trade wars and high interest rates are exacerbating the situation, with mortgage rates above 7%. Experts tell WCNC they warn that waiting to buy a home could have long-term financial impacts, so some advise not to delay, even in a tough market.
